The Namibian Coast Conservation and Management Project aims at Strengthening conservation, sustainable use and mainstreaming of biodiversity in coastal and marine ecosystems. The project consists of the following components: Component 1) will address three key areas identified by the government from a policy, legal, institutional, financial and planning point of stand, conducive to biodiversity conservation and sustainable use. Component 2) will link to the ongoing decentralization process as well as contribute to improved effectiveness of institutions engaged in Integrated Coastal Zone Management (ICZM) by filling the capacity gap at local, regional and national levels. Component 3) will contribute to the overall framework for ICZM along the Namibian Coast by using targeted investments and activities to address on-the-ground gaps in coastal biodiversity conservation. Component 4) will support the establishment and operation of a Project Coordination Office (PCO) housed in the Erongo Regional Council that will facilitate satisfactory achievements.
